DAZN is the new home for AEW PPVs, and tonight it presents the first big show of the year as Los Angeles hosts Revolution 2026.
The event is headlined by 'Hangman' Adam Page's final shot at the AEW World Heavyweight Championship as he takes on champion MJF in a Texas Deathmatch for the gold.
Elsewhere, the latest encounter between FTR and The Young Bucks takes place as they battle for the AEW Tag Team Championships, and women's champion Thekla puts her strap on the line in a two-out-of-three falls match against Kris Statlander.
Here's all you need to know about AEW Revolution 2026.
Revolution takes place at the Crypto.com Arena in Los Angeles, California.
